In the vibrant world of 17th-century Dutch painting, "Dans la cuisine" by Hendrik Martensz Sorgh stands out for its intimate atmosphere and meticulous attention to detail. This artwork, capturing a moment of everyday life, transports the viewer to the heart of a lively kitchen, where the characters seem to come alive under the artist's skillful brushwork. The play of light and color, along with the carefully orchestrated composition, invites a complete immersion into this domestic scene. The art print of this piece allows for a rediscovery of the richness of daily life in that era, while highlighting Sorgh's undeniable talent. Style and uniqueness of the work Hendrik Martensz Sorgh's style is characterized by a realistic approach, where each element of the composition is thoughtfully considered. In "Dans la cuisine," the details are remarkably precise, from kitchen utensils to the expressions of the characters. The artist manages to create a warm, almost tangible atmosphere, where the viewer can almost smell the food being prepared. Sorgh uses earthy tones and subtle contrasts to bring his scene to life, emphasizing the textures of the materials. This realism, combined with an almost poetic sensitivity, makes this work a true masterpiece, capturing a fleeting moment of daily life, elevated by art. The artist and his influence Hendrik Martensz Sorgh, active during the 17th century in Amsterdam, is often regarded as a major representative of genre painting, which highlights scenes of everyday life. His work fits into an artistic context where the depiction of domestic life takes on new significance, reflecting the values and concerns of his time. Influenced by masters such as Pieter de Hooch and Jan Vermeer, Sorgh develops a style that is uniquely his own, blending realism with sensitivity. His works, both simple and profound, reveal a careful observation of human life, making him an essential artist of his era.
